William Cobb |

William Cobb is a native of Demopolis. He graduated from Livingston State University, and was Writer-in-Residence and taught at the University of Montavello for three decades.
In 1984, he was named Livingston's Distinguished Alumnus of the Year and in 1999 was named Alabama Library Association Author of the Year. His novel A Walk Through Fire was was named a finalist for the IPPY (Independent Publishers' "Book of the Year") and was nominated for the Pulitzer Prize.
He has written six novels and a book of short stories. William is a respected playwright, having three off-Broadway productions, including Sunday's Child, which starred Academy Award-winning actress Celeste Holm.
